Emma Viscidi is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Genetics and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Emma Viscidi has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 454 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ience, 5 papers in Genetics and 3 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Emma Viscidi’s work include Genetics and Neurodevelopmental Disorders (4 papers),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(4 papers) and Neurogenetic and Muscular Disorders Research (3 papers). Emma Viscidi is often cited by papers focused on Genetics and Neurodevelopmental Disorders (4 papers),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(4 papers) and Neurogenetic and Muscular Disorders Research (3 papers). Emma Viscidi collaborates with scholars based in United States and Germany. Emma Viscidi's co-authors include Eric M. Morrow, Elizabeth W. Triche, Sarah Spence, Tsung‐Ung W. Woo, Amy Kim, Matthew F. Pescosolido, Robert M. Joseph, Julia A. O’Rourke, Yamini J. Howe and Richard N. Jones and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Neurology and JNCI Journal of the National Cancer Institute.
